Union Minister Nitin Gadkari has courted fresh controversy after asking journalists to "keep the packages (money) they get during the election season" from Congress and NCP.
"In the next 10-12 days, you journalists will have 'Laxmi darshan'," Gadkari said at a poll rally in Sawantwadi in coastal Konkan on Saturday.
